CC BY-NC-ND 4.0 explained
Creative Commons (CC): Creative Commons licenses are a set of permissions that allow creators to share their work with others while specifying how it can be used.
Attribution (BY): This part of the license requires anyone using the work to give appropriate credit to the original creator. If you use content under this license, you must acknowledge the author.
NonCommercial (NC): This means that the work cannot be used for commercial purposes. You can’t make money directly from the work if it’s under this license. Education use is permitted.
NoDerivs (ND): NoDerivs indicates that you cannot create derivative works based on the original. In other words, you can’t modify, adapt, or build upon the work.

Principles
Principle 1: Recognition and respect of Indigenous cultural rights
We support the rights of Indigenous people and communities to own, protect, maintain, control and benefit from their cultural heritage. These rights should be respected.
Principle 2: Self-determination
We support the notion that Indigenous people have the right to self-determination and should have control over decisions that affect their arts and cultural affairs.
Principle 3: Communication, consultation, and consent
We believe Indigenous people have the right to be consulted and give their free prior informed consent for the use of their cultural heritage.
Principle 4: Interpretation
We recognise Indigenous people as the primary guardians and interpreters of their cultural heritage.
Principle 5: Cultural integrity and authenticity
We understand that maintaining the integrity of cultural heritage is often seen as vital to the continued practice of culture.
Principle 6: Secrecy and confidentiality
We understand that Indigenous people hold parts of their cultural heritage to be secret and sacred. Confidentiality concerning aspects of Indigenous peoples’ personal and cultural affairs will be respected.
Principle 7: Attribution
Indigenous people will be acknowledged and attributed as the traditional owners and custodians of their cultural heritage.
Principle 8: Benefit sharing
We very much support the notion that Indigenous people and communities have the right to benefit from their contribution and for the sharing of their cultural heritage, particularly if commercially applied.
Principle 9: Continuing cultures
Indigenous cultures are dynamic and evolving, and the protocols within each group and community will also change. Consultation and free prior informed consent are ongoing processes.
Principle 10: Recognition and protection
We support the protection of cultural heritage and intellectual property rights in that cultural heritage. Laws, policies and contracts will be developed and implemented to respect these rights.
Principle 11: ICIP in Perpetuity
Any Media content collected by Wind and Sky will be maintained in trust and in perpetuity to the best of our abilities.
